Calculates federal student aid eligibility and Estimated Family Contribution (EFC). Does NOT include state aid OR scholarships.
Calculates estimated cost of attendance for different options (4 year public/private, 2 year public/private).
Allows students to transfer data to FAFSA web app.
AVAILABLE IN SPANISH!!!!
Based on current year information (does not project for inflation or any future FAFSA legislation).
Account will deactivate after 45 days of non-use.
Online FAFSA completion is the only option
unless a student requests a paper copy.
